Israel (Izzy) Adesanya (24-2-0) reclaimed UFC middleweight supremacy with a bludgeoning knockout of arch nemesis, Alex “Poatan” Pereira (7-2-0) at the Kaseya Center in Miami, Florida on Sunday.

In front of 19,032 fans, “The Last Stylebender” closed the rematch with 39 seconds left in the second round with what many believe to already be a knockout of the year contender.

In victory, Adesanya sees himself back in the win column after suffering his only middleweight defeat at UFC 281 this past November to Pereira.

“They say revenge is sweet, and if you know me, I’ve got a sweet tooth,” Adesanya said.

Both fighters came out the gate cautiously downloading information, and trading calf kicks for majority of the first round.

After a measured first round, the action piled up significantly in the second. Pereira employed a similar tactic to that of their first bout, constantly trying to use forward pressure to press Izzy to the cage and land that explosive left hook.

Izzy appeared to be a man on a mission, being much more aggressive than usual. Taking advantage of his patented lateral movement to nullify Pereira’s pressure, but also being victim to many of Pereira’s leg kicks, hurting him twice significantly.

By targeting the body with perfect roundhouse kicks, Izzy set up the head kick as Poatan dropped his hands expecting a body kick. But Pereira unfazed, kept pressing forward. Finding Izzy against the cage on several occurrences, he attempted to tee off and land devastating blows, but Izzy avoided. Adesanya found that Pereira dropped his hands significantly every time they met on the fence, which came to the Brazilians demise.

As Pereira recklessly threw punches in close quarters, Adesanya took refuge against the cage, playing possum for the Brazilian’s onslaught. But with lightning-fast reflexes, Adesanya countered with a missile of a right hand that caught Pereira square on the button, sending him reeling backward.

As the stunned Pereira struggled to regain his footing, Adesanya followed up with a powerful right hand that served as the coup de grâce – the proverbial nail in the coffin – and sent Pereira crashing to the mat, unconscious. Not content to leave anything to chance, Adesanya delivered a final hammerfist blow which looked personal.

Israel Adesanya left the arena with a performance of the night, and $50,000 extra to play with.

Dubbed “the greatest celebration of all time” by the fans, Izzy towered over Poatan’s lifeless body and gestured three bow and arrow movements as Pereira is known to be in a Brazilian hunting tribe, as well as calling himself the hunter.

Their rivalry commenced in 2016 where the two faced twice in kickboxing with Pereira having it over Izzy in both their fights, including one by KO. Izzy went on to become one of the best middleweights of all time in MMA while his kryptonite loomed in the background. Poatan hunted him down across multiple MMA promotions and snatched a victory against Izzy late in the 5th round in 2022.

Champions who lose their belt and fight an immediate rematch are 3-12 in the UFC. In history, Izzy loses this fight. He made all the previous losses to Poatan a glitch in his matrix. He rewrote the script. He showed the world that despite the odds, with hard work and dedication, unfathomable obstacles can be overcome.

“In his story, I’m the antagonist. In his story, I’m the bad guy. But tonight, it’s my story. History,” the Nigerian said.

“People… I hope every one of you can feel this level of happiness one time in your life… but guess what, you will never feel this level of happiness if you don’t go for it. When they knock you down, talk down on you, find your resolve, fortify your mind” he said.
